why do different age groups eat different types of food​

During childhood, children tend to vary their food intake (spontaneously) to match their growth patterns. Children's food needs vary widely, depending on their growth and their level of physical activity. Like energy needs, a child's needs for protein, vitamins and minerals increase with age.
